Electrons in a certain energy level n=n₁, can emit 3 spectral lines. When they are in another energy level, n=n₂. They can emit 6 spectral lines. The orbital speed of the electrons in the two orbits are in the ratio
Options
(a) (4:3)
(b) (3:4)
(c) (2:1)
(d) (1:2)
Correct Answer:
(4:3)
